本文目录导读:
在当今信息化时代,数据已经成为企业、组织和个人宝贵的资产,为了更好地管理和处理这些数据,关系数据库应运而生,而关系数据库的标准语言——SQL(Structured Query Language),则是处理这些数据的重要工具,本文将深入解析SQL的起源、特点以及其在关系数据库中的应用。
SQL的起源
SQL的全称是Structured Query Language,意为结构化查询语言,它起源于1970年代,由IBM公司的研究员E.F. Codd发明,Codd博士提出了关系模型,为数据库的发展奠定了基础,随后,SQL逐渐成为关系数据库的标准语言。
SQL的特点
1、简洁明了:SQL语句简洁明了,易于理解和记忆,用户可以通过简单的语句完成复杂的数据库操作。
图片来源于网络,如有侵权联系删除
2、功能强大:SQL支持多种数据库操作,包括数据查询、数据插入、数据更新和数据删除等。
3、通用性强:SQL适用于各种关系数据库系统,如MySQL、Oracle、SQL Server等。
4、高效性:SQL语句经过优化,执行速度快,能够满足大量数据的处理需求。
5、安全性:SQL提供了丰富的权限控制功能,确保数据的安全性和完整性。
SQL的应用
1、数据查询
数据查询是SQL最基本的功能,通过SELECT语句,用户可以检索数据库中的数据,以下是一个简单的查询示例:
SELECT * FROM students WHERE age > 18;
此查询语句表示从students表中查询年龄大于18岁的学生信息。
图片来源于网络,如有侵权联系删除
2、数据插入
数据插入功能允许用户向数据库中添加新数据,以下是一个数据插入的示例:
INSERT INTO students (name, age, class) VALUES ('张三', 20, '计算机科学');
此语句表示向students表中插入一条新记录,包含姓名、年龄和班级信息。
3、数据更新
数据更新功能允许用户修改数据库中的数据,以下是一个数据更新的示例:
UPDATE students SET age = 21 WHERE name = '张三';
此语句表示将students表中名为张三的学生的年龄修改为21岁。
4、数据删除
图片来源于网络,如有侵权联系删除
数据删除功能允许用户从数据库中删除数据,以下是一个数据删除的示例:
DELETE FROM students WHERE age = 20;
此语句表示删除students表中年龄为20岁的学生记录。
SQL的未来
随着大数据、云计算等技术的发展,SQL在数据库领域的应用将越来越广泛,SQL将不断优化和扩展,以适应不断变化的数据处理需求。
SQL作为关系数据库的标准语言,在数据处理领域具有举足轻重的地位,掌握SQL,将为用户在数据管理、分析和挖掘等方面提供强大的支持。
评论列表